Nangong Climate

Nangong has an average annual temperature of 13.5°C (56°F) and receives about 492 mm of precipitation per year. The warmest month is July and the coldest is January. Figures are 1970–2000 climate normals.

Nangong — monthly temperature & precipitation (1970–2000 normals) · Source: WorldClim 2.1
MonthAvg (°C/°F)Precip
January-3° / 27°4 mm
February0° / 32°6 mm
March7° / 45°9 mm
April15° / 59°30 mm
May21° / 71°26 mm
June26° / 80°50 mm
July27° / 81°151 mm
August26° / 79°140 mm
September21° / 70°37 mm
October15° / 58°19 mm
November6° / 43°16 mm
December0° / 31°4 mm

1970–2000 normals from WorldClim 2.1 (~9 km grid). Precipitation can be less precise near mountains or coastlines, where rainfall varies sharply over short distances.

Best time to visit Nangong

The most comfortable months to visit Nangong are typically May, September and October, when temperatures are mildest and rainfall is relatively low. The hottest month is July (around 32°C high). The coldest is January (near -8°C low). July is usually the wettest month.
